Letter: County can do better with trash on holidays

On Thursday, Dec. 31, at 10:15 a.m., I lined up at the Hilton Head Island recycling center off of Dillon Road. I left after recycling all my waste articles, and passed the line of cars waiting to enter the recycling center. It stretched all the way out to Dillon Road, with some vehicles parked on Dillon Road waiting to enter the recycling center. Vehicles were parking down by the yard trash bin, and drivers were walking back up to the bins for household garbage.

This center is closed on Wednesdays, but with New Year's Day falling on Friday, the center was closed two days that week. Would it be possible to keep this center open on the Wednesdays during a week that has a holiday?

With the center open on Wednesday during a holiday week, perhaps this extra day would help cut back the long lines of vehicles that want to recycle their waste.

On Wednesdays, repair work is supposed to be done to the center's trash bins, but that Thursday, the bin next to the bin for cardboard was being repaired.

Also, I understand the workers at the center do not receive a day's pay for holidays off, so being able to work on a Wednesday of a week with a holiday in it would give their paycheck a boost.

George Breslaw
